/Zephyr-Core-3.6.0/arch/x86/core/ia32/ |
D | soft_float_stubs.c | 12 * @brief Provide soft float function stubs for long double operations. 14 * GCC soft float does not support long double so these need to be 22 __weak void __addtf3(long double a, long double b) in __addtf3() 27 __weak void __addxf3(long double a, long double b) in __addxf3() 32 __weak void __subtf3(long double a, long double b) in __subtf3() 37 __weak void __subxf3(long double a, long double b) in __subxf3() 42 __weak void __multf3(long double a, long double b) in __multf3() 47 __weak void __mulxf3(long double a, long double b) in __mulxf3() 52 __weak void __divtf3(long double a, long double b) in __divtf3() 57 __weak void __divxf3(long double a, long double b) in __divxf3() [all …]
|
/Zephyr-Core-3.6.0/include/zephyr/arch/arm64/ |
D | arm-smccc.h | 15 unsigned long a0; 16 unsigned long a1; 17 unsigned long a2; 18 unsigned long a3; 19 unsigned long a4; 20 unsigned long a5; 21 unsigned long a6; 22 unsigned long a7; 40 void arm_smccc_hvc(unsigned long a0, unsigned long a1, 41 unsigned long a2, unsigned long a3, [all …]
|
/Zephyr-Core-3.6.0/include/zephyr/arch/mips/ |
D | exception.h | 21 unsigned long ra; /* return address */ 22 unsigned long gp; /* global pointer */ 24 unsigned long t0; /* Caller-saved temporary register */ 25 unsigned long t1; /* Caller-saved temporary register */ 26 unsigned long t2; /* Caller-saved temporary register */ 27 unsigned long t3; /* Caller-saved temporary register */ 28 unsigned long t4; /* Caller-saved temporary register */ 29 unsigned long t5; /* Caller-saved temporary register */ 30 unsigned long t6; /* Caller-saved temporary register */ 31 unsigned long t7; /* Caller-saved temporary register */ [all …]
|
D | thread.h | 32 unsigned long sp; /* Stack pointer */ 34 unsigned long s0; /* saved register */ 35 unsigned long s1; /* saved register */ 36 unsigned long s2; /* saved register */ 37 unsigned long s3; /* saved register */ 38 unsigned long s4; /* saved register */ 39 unsigned long s5; /* saved register */ 40 unsigned long s6; /* saved register */ 41 unsigned long s7; /* saved register */ 42 unsigned long s8; /* saved register AKA fp */
|
/Zephyr-Core-3.6.0/soc/riscv/nordic_nrf/common/vpr/ |
D | soc_isr_stacking.h | 21 unsigned long s0; \ 22 unsigned long mstatus; \ 23 unsigned long tp; \ 26 unsigned long t2; \ 27 unsigned long ra; \ 28 unsigned long t0; \ 29 unsigned long t1; \ 30 unsigned long a4; \ 31 unsigned long a5; \ 32 unsigned long a2; \ [all …]
|
/Zephyr-Core-3.6.0/arch/common/ |
D | semihost.c | 13 long zero; 18 long mode; 19 long path_len; 23 long fd; 27 long fd; 31 long fd; 32 long offset; 36 long fd; 38 long len; 42 long fd; [all …]
|
/Zephyr-Core-3.6.0/include/zephyr/arch/x86/intel64/ |
D | arch.h | 48 unsigned long key; in arch_irq_lock() 62 unsigned long rbx; 63 unsigned long r12; 64 unsigned long r13; 65 unsigned long r14; 66 unsigned long r15; 68 unsigned long rbp; 71 unsigned long rax; 72 unsigned long rcx; 73 unsigned long rdx; [all …]
|
/Zephyr-Core-3.6.0/boards/arm/s32z270dc2_r52/support/ |
D | startup.cmm | 114 Data.Set EAXI:0x41850014 %LE %Long 0x0 115 Data.Set EAXI:0x41850018 %LE %Long 0x0 116 Data.Set EAXI:0x4185001C %LE %Long 0x0 119 Data.Set DP:0x1C100c0 %LE %Long 0x3cf3cf00 120 Data.Set DP:0x1C100c8 %LE %Long 0x3cf3cf00 130 Data.Set EZAXI:&cfgCoreAddr %Long 0yXXXXxxxxXXXXxxxxXXXXxxxxXXXXx&(thumbBit)x&(spltLckBit) ; CFG_C… 133 Data.Set EAXI:&rtuStartAddr %Long 0xFFFEF7FF 190 Data.Set EAXI:0x41900300 %LE %Long 0x5 191 Data.Set EAXI:0x41900304 %LE %Long 0x1 192 Data.Set EAXI:0x41900000 %LE %Long 0x5AF0 [all …]
|
/Zephyr-Core-3.6.0/arch/arm/core/ |
D | header.S | 18 .long z_main_stack + CONFIG_MAIN_STACK_SIZE 19 .long z_arm_reset 22 .long 0 // reserved 24 .long 0 // reserved 25 .long 0 // reserved 26 .long 0 // reserved 27 .long 0 // reserved 28 .long 0 // reserved 29 .long 0 // reserved 30 .long 0 // reserved [all …]
|
/Zephyr-Core-3.6.0/include/zephyr/arch/riscv/ |
D | thread.h | 30 unsigned long sp; /* Stack pointer, (x2 register) */ 31 unsigned long ra; /* return address */ 33 unsigned long s0; /* saved register/frame pointer */ 34 unsigned long s1; /* saved register */ 36 unsigned long s2; /* saved register */ 37 unsigned long s3; /* saved register */ 38 unsigned long s4; /* saved register */ 39 unsigned long s5; /* saved register */ 40 unsigned long s6; /* saved register */ 41 unsigned long s7; /* saved register */ [all …]
|
D | syscall.h | 44 register unsigned long a0 __asm__ ("a0") = arg1; in arch_syscall_invoke6() 45 register unsigned long a1 __asm__ ("a1") = arg2; in arch_syscall_invoke6() 46 register unsigned long a2 __asm__ ("a2") = arg3; in arch_syscall_invoke6() 47 register unsigned long a3 __asm__ ("a3") = arg4; in arch_syscall_invoke6() 48 register unsigned long a4 __asm__ ("a4") = arg5; in arch_syscall_invoke6() 49 register unsigned long a5 __asm__ ("a5") = arg6; in arch_syscall_invoke6() 50 register unsigned long t0 __asm__ ("t0") = call_id; in arch_syscall_invoke6() 65 register unsigned long a0 __asm__ ("a0") = arg1; in arch_syscall_invoke5() 66 register unsigned long a1 __asm__ ("a1") = arg2; in arch_syscall_invoke5() 67 register unsigned long a2 __asm__ ("a2") = arg3; in arch_syscall_invoke5() [all …]
|
D | exception.h | 52 unsigned long ra; /* return address */ 54 unsigned long t0; /* Caller-saved temporary register */ 55 unsigned long t1; /* Caller-saved temporary register */ 56 unsigned long t2; /* Caller-saved temporary register */ 58 unsigned long t3; /* Caller-saved temporary register */ 59 unsigned long t4; /* Caller-saved temporary register */ 60 unsigned long t5; /* Caller-saved temporary register */ 61 unsigned long t6; /* Caller-saved temporary register */ 64 unsigned long a0; /* function argument/return value */ 65 unsigned long a1; /* function argument */ [all …]
|
/Zephyr-Core-3.6.0/include/zephyr/toolchain/ |
D | zephyr_stdint.h | 12 * (questionably) define __INT32_TYPE__ and derivatives as a long int 13 * which makes the printf format checker to complain about long vs int 42 #define __INT64_TYPE__ long long int 43 #define __UINT64_TYPE__ unsigned long long int 51 * (even when __INT32_TYPE__ is a long int) or a long int. Let's redefine 52 * it to a long int to get some uniformity. Doing so also makes it compatible 53 * with LP64 (64-bit) targets where a long is always 64-bit wide. 57 #error "unexpected size difference between pointers and long ints" 62 #define __INTPTR_TYPE__ long int 63 #define __UINTPTR_TYPE__ long unsigned int
|
D | xcc_missing_defs.h | 65 #define __INTPTR_TYPE__ long int 74 #define __UINTPTR_TYPE__ long unsigned int 100 #define __INT64_TYPE__ long long int 115 #define __INT_FAST64_TYPE__ long long int 131 #define __INT_LEAST64_TYPE__ long long int 144 #define __UINT64_TYPE__ long long unsigned int 156 #define __UINT_FAST64_TYPE__ long long unsigned int 168 #define __UINT_LEAST64_TYPE__ long long unsigned int
|
/Zephyr-Core-3.6.0/scripts/native_simulator/common/src/ |
D | nsi_host_trampolines.c | 14 void *nsi_host_calloc(unsigned long nmemb, unsigned long size) in nsi_host_calloc() 29 char *nsi_host_getcwd(char *buf, unsigned long size) in nsi_host_getcwd() 39 void *nsi_host_malloc(unsigned long size) in nsi_host_malloc() 49 long nsi_host_random(void) in nsi_host_random() 54 long nsi_host_read(int fd, void *buffer, unsigned long size) in nsi_host_read() 59 void *nsi_host_realloc(void *ptr, unsigned long size) in nsi_host_realloc() 74 long nsi_host_write(int fd, void *buffer, unsigned long size) in nsi_host_write()
|
/Zephyr-Core-3.6.0/include/zephyr/drivers/sip_svc/ |
D | sip_svc_driver.h | 28 typedef void (*sip_supervisory_call_t)(const struct device *dev, unsigned long function_id, 29 unsigned long arg0, unsigned long arg1, unsigned long arg2, 30 unsigned long arg3, unsigned long arg4, unsigned long arg5, 31 unsigned long arg6, struct arm_smccc_res *res); 71 typedef int (*sip_svc_plat_async_res_req_t)(const struct device *dev, unsigned long *a0, 72 unsigned long *a1, unsigned long *a2, unsigned long *a3, 73 unsigned long *a4, unsigned long *a5, unsigned long *a6, 74 unsigned long *a7, char *buf, size_t size); 120 __syscall void sip_supervisory_call(const struct device *dev, unsigned long function_id, 121 unsigned long arg0, unsigned long arg1, unsigned long arg2, [all …]
|
/Zephyr-Core-3.6.0/scripts/native_simulator/common/src/include/ |
D | nsi_host_trampolines.h | 25 void *nsi_host_calloc(unsigned long nmemb, unsigned long size); 29 char *nsi_host_getcwd(char *buf, unsigned long size); 31 void *nsi_host_malloc(unsigned long size); 34 long nsi_host_random(void); 35 long nsi_host_read(int fd, void *buffer, unsigned long size); 36 void *nsi_host_realloc(void *ptr, unsigned long size); 39 long nsi_host_write(int fd, void *buffer, unsigned long size);
|
/Zephyr-Core-3.6.0/lib/libc/minimal/include/ |
D | stdlib.h | 19 unsigned long strtoul(const char *nptr, char **endptr, int base); 20 long strtol(const char *nptr, char **endptr, int base); 21 unsigned long long strtoull(const char *nptr, char **endptr, int base); 22 long long strtoll(const char *nptr, char **endptr, int base); 63 static inline long labs(long __n) in labs() 68 static inline long long llabs(long long __n) in llabs()
|
/Zephyr-Core-3.6.0/lib/libc/minimal/source/stdlib/ |
D | strtoull.c | 38 * Convert a string to an unsigned long long integer. 43 unsigned long long strtoull(const char *nptr, char **endptr, register int base) in strtoull() 46 register unsigned long long acc; in strtoull() 48 register unsigned long long cutoff; in strtoull() 74 cutoff = (unsigned long long)ULLONG_MAX / (unsigned long long)base; in strtoull() 75 cutlim = (unsigned long long)ULLONG_MAX % (unsigned long long)base; in strtoull()
|
/Zephyr-Core-3.6.0/include/zephyr/shell/ |
D | shell_string_conv.h | 17 /** @brief String to long conversion with error check. 30 * @return Converted long value. 32 long shell_strtol(const char *str, int base, int *err); 34 /** @brief String to unsigned long conversion with error check. 47 * @return Converted unsigned long value. 49 unsigned long shell_strtoul(const char *str, int base, int *err); 51 /** @brief String to unsigned long long conversion with error check. 64 * @return Converted unsigned long long value. 66 unsigned long long shell_strtoull(const char *str, int base, int *err);
|
/Zephyr-Core-3.6.0/tests/arch/arm64/arm64_smc_call/src/ |
D | main.c | 17 typedef void (*smc_call_method_t)(unsigned long, unsigned long, 18 unsigned long, unsigned long, 19 unsigned long, unsigned long, 20 unsigned long, unsigned long,
|
/Zephyr-Core-3.6.0/tests/kernel/common/src/ |
D | multilib.c | 22 volatile long long a = 100; in ZTEST() 23 volatile long long b = 3; in ZTEST() 24 volatile long long c = a / b; in ZTEST()
|
/Zephyr-Core-3.6.0/include/zephyr/arch/common/ |
D | semihost.h | 114 long semihost_exec(enum semihost_instr instr, void *args); 140 long semihost_open(const char *path, long mode); 150 long semihost_close(long fd); 160 long semihost_flen(long fd); 171 long semihost_seek(long fd, long offset); 183 long semihost_read(long fd, void *buf, long len); 195 long semihost_write(long fd, const void *buf, long len);
|
/Zephyr-Core-3.6.0/drivers/sip_svc/ |
D | sip_smc_intel_socfpga.c | 117 static int intel_sip_smc_plat_async_res_req(const struct device *dev, unsigned long *a0, in intel_sip_smc_plat_async_res_req() 118 unsigned long *a1, unsigned long *a2, unsigned long *a3, in intel_sip_smc_plat_async_res_req() 119 unsigned long *a4, unsigned long *a5, unsigned long *a6, in intel_sip_smc_plat_async_res_req() 120 unsigned long *a7, char *buf, size_t size) in intel_sip_smc_plat_async_res_req() 127 *a2 = (unsigned long)buf; in intel_sip_smc_plat_async_res_req() 141 if (((long)res->a0) <= SMC_STATUS_OKAY) { in intel_sip_smc_plat_async_res_res() 147 LOG_INF("There is no valid polling response %ld", (long)res->a0); in intel_sip_smc_plat_async_res_res() 167 static void intel_sip_secure_monitor_call(const struct device *dev, unsigned long function_id, in intel_sip_secure_monitor_call() 168 unsigned long arg0, unsigned long arg1, in intel_sip_secure_monitor_call() 169 unsigned long arg2, unsigned long arg3, in intel_sip_secure_monitor_call() [all …]
|
/Zephyr-Core-3.6.0/arch/mips/core/ |
D | thread.c | 30 stack_init->a0 = (unsigned long)entry; in arch_new_thread() 31 stack_init->a1 = (unsigned long)p1; in arch_new_thread() 32 stack_init->a2 = (unsigned long)p2; in arch_new_thread() 33 stack_init->a3 = (unsigned long)p3; in arch_new_thread() 38 stack_init->epc = (unsigned long)z_thread_entry; in arch_new_thread() 40 thread->callee_saved.sp = (unsigned long)stack_init; in arch_new_thread()
|